Garden Invaders
Non-native plant invaders are taking over garden and woodland, crowding out native wildflowers and shrubs. Learn effective removal technique for 5 of the invasives and the alternative shrubs and vines that are suggested replacements.
Additional Information
Learn how to effectively eliminate from your landscape the non-native invaders bush honeysuckle, Japanese honeysuckle, bamboo, English ivy, and wintercreeper. This presentation helps you learn to identify the problem plants, details what works and doesn't work for their removal and then moves into 14 fabulous replacement plants from the Plants of Merit program.
